WPF与Oracle数据库的无缝结合(wpforacle)
《WPF与Oracle数据库的无缝结合》
Windows Presentation Foundation(简称WPF)是用于构建Windows应用程序的前端框架,其独特的使用者体验(UX)视觉封装和强大的交互技术被越来越多的企业采用。而Oracle公司提供的Oracle数据库是最受欢迎的关系型数据库,其稳定性和支持是它的重要优势。
WPF与Oracle数据库的无缝结合给企业带来了更多的可能性,可以使用户使用WPF创建现代,动态,数据驱动的应用程序。用户可以在WPF应用程序中将数据存储在Oracle数据库中,并从中取出数据。
结合WPF和Oracle数据库需要两个步骤,第一阶段是连接,第二步是取数。第一步,连接Oracle数据库,需要获取连接字符串和连接数据库的安全信息,并利用它们创建OracleConnection实例:
OracleConnection conn;
conn = new OracleConnection("Data Source=oracle;User ID=your_user;Password=your_password;"); conn.Open();
第二步,要实现从Oracle数据库中取数,最常用的方法就是使用Ado.net技术,可以使用OracleDataAdapter对象构建数据集来操作数据:
string strSql = "SELECT * FROM tablename";
OracleDataAdapter adapter = new OracleDataAdapter(strSql,conn);
DataSet ds = new DataSet(); adapter.Fill(ds);
DataTable dtResult = ds.Tables["tablename"];
取得了数据表后,可以利用WPF的Datagrid来加载数据,它具有良好的用户界面,可以添加、编辑、删除、搜索等各种增强功能:
WPF与Oracle数据库的无缝结合,让用户可以利用WPF应用程序轻松实现数据交互和存储,创建出动态,现代,迷人的应用程序。WPF和Oracle数据库的结合让开发者有更多的灵活性,可以从根本上改变用户的体验,并且可以确保高稳定性和可靠性。